Carrier limits compared
Every major carrier publishes a maximum combined length plus girth. Exceeding the limit triggers either oversize surcharges or outright rejection.
| Carrier | Max length + girth | Details |
|---|---|---|
| UPS Ground | 165 in / 419 cm | View → |
| FedEx Ground | 165 in / 419 cm | View → |
| USPS | 108 in / 274 cm | View → |
| DHL Express | 157 in / 399 cm | View → |
| Royal Mail | 118 in / 300 cm | View → |
| Canada Post | 118 in / 300 cm | View → |
| Australia Post | 55 in / 140 cm | View → |
How girth is calculated
For a rectangular box, girth equals twice the sum of the two smaller dimensions:
girth = 2 × (width + height)
length + girth = length + 2 × (width + height)
For a cylindrical tube, girth is the circumference of the circular cross-section:
girth = π × diameter
length + girth = length + π × diameter
Always measure outer dimensions of the finished package, including any padding, wrapping, or protrusions. Carriers round up to the next whole inch when verifying.
